# Why is pork forbidden in Islam?
Pork is prohibited in Islam as a direct commandment from God. The Quran explicitly forbids its consumption in multiple verses.
**Quranic Prohibition:**
'He has only forbidden to you dead animals, blood, the flesh of swine, and that which has been dedicated to other than Allah.' (Quran 2:173)
**Reasons for the Prohibition:**
**1. Divine Command:**
The primary reason is obedience to God. Muslims trust that God's commands are for their benefit, even if they don't fully understand the wisdom behind them.
**2. Health Considerations:**
Modern science has identified several health concerns with pork:
- Higher risk of parasites (trichinosis, tapeworms)
- Higher fat content and cholesterol
- Potential for foodborne illnesses
- Pigs are scavengers and consume waste
However, Muslims abstain from pork primarily out of religious obedience, not just health concerns.
**3. Spiritual Purity:**
Islam emphasizes both physical and spiritual cleanliness. Dietary laws are part of maintaining spiritual purity and discipline.
**Similar Prohibitions:**
It's worth noting that pork is also forbidden in Judaism (Leviticus 11:7-8), showing consistency across Abrahamic faiths.
**Practical Application:**
Muslims avoid:
- Pork meat in any form
- Products containing pork derivatives (gelatin, lard)
- Food cooked with pork or its byproducts
This prohibition is one of the clear boundaries in Islam, and observing it is an act of worship and submission to God's will.
